Abstract

L.Garde, Inc. proposes to design and develop a modular range of freestanding Lightweight Illuminating Towers (LiT) in response to NASA#39;s need fornbsp;quot;lightweight reflectors to redirect sunlight onto solar arrays or into dark cratersquot;. The LiT will consist of two subassemblies, (1) reflector with attendant mast, tilt drive, azimuth drive, and leveler, and (2) mass and volume efficient truss structure with stabilizing legs.nbsp;The two main LiT-specific challenges are tower height and robotic deployment of wide-base legs, using a lightweight and compact structure. In Phase I, L.Garde will prove the feasibility of the proposed LiT innovations using design, analysis, and test.nbsp;In Phase II, L.Garde will aim to develop a system design that will allow for the ground testing and demonstration of a LiT reflector tower (including stabilizing legs, slew, leveling, etc.).nbsp;
